Produktbeschreibung
Emily Dickinson, A User´s Guide presents a comprehensive introduction to the life and works of Emily Dickinson, Offers a richly appreciative biographical and critical introduction to America´s most widely admired woman poet * Written by a world-renowned Emily Dickinson scholar and American literary critic * Represents the only book that reads Dickinson through her manuscripts, the print editions of her work, and the major digital Dickinson editions published since 1994 * The User´s Guide is a new kind of book for a new era of reading * Is the only book that is an introduction to the poet, her work, and her receptions among readers * Is the only book that presents new biography and textual discoveries that have just come to light in 2011 * Interprets Dickinson through the dynamic interchange between the reader´s sense of her life and her work * Draws on prominent critical views from the past century, including sentimental, modernist, new critical, psychological, feminist, queer, and postmodernist readings
